首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从控制器调用option标签的name属性

从控制器调用option标签的name属性,可以通过以下步骤实现:

  1. 在前端页面中,使用HTML的select标签创建一个下拉列表,其中的每个选项使用option标签表示,并为每个option标签设置name属性。例如:
代码语言:html
复制
<select id="mySelect">
  <option name="option1">Option 1</option>
  <option name="option2">Option 2</option>
  <option name="option3">Option 3</option>
</select>
  1. 在控制器中,使用JavaScript或其他适合的编程语言获取该下拉列表元素,并访问其选中的option标签的name属性。例如,使用JavaScript的getElementById方法获取下拉列表元素,并使用selectedIndex属性获取选中的索引:
代码语言:javascript
复制
var selectElement = document.getElementById("mySelect");
var selectedOption = selectElement.options[selectElement.selectedIndex];
var selectedOptionName = selectedOption.getAttribute("name");
  1. 现在,变量selectedOptionName中存储了选中的option标签的name属性值,可以根据需要进行进一步处理或使用。

这种方法适用于前端页面中的简单下拉列表,通过获取选中的option标签的name属性,可以在控制器中进行后续操作,如根据选项名称执行不同的逻辑或发送请求等。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

li看html标签属性(attribute)和dom元素属性(property)

li 元素 value属性(property) 有特殊作用,其值只能是数字 如果设置值不是数字将会只反应到元素 value属性(attribute)....HTML 标签 value 属性 定义和用法 value 属性规定规定列表项目的数字。接下来列表项目会该数字开始进行升序排列。...当为有序排列时可以清楚看到value作用 部分区别 对象来说,attribute是html文档上标签属性,而property则是对应dom元素自身属性。...操作方法上来看,attribute可以通过dom core规范接口 getAttribute和setAttribute....参考资料 不知道为何用value取值拿到是0,getAttribute方法拿到就是value属性值。

2.7K10
  • 【说站】java反射如何调用指定属性

    java反射如何调用指定属性 说明 1、在反射机制中,可以直接通过Field类操作类中属性。 2、通过Field类提供set()和get()方法完成设置和获取属性内容操作。...实例 @Test public void testField() throws Exception {     Class clazz = Person.class;       //创建运行时类对象...    Person p = (Person) clazz.newInstance();       //1. getDeclaredField(String fieldName):获取运行时类中指定变量名属性...    Field name = clazz.getDeclaredField("name");       //2.保证当前属性是可访问     name.setAccessible(true);...    //3.获取、设置指定对象属性值     name.set(p,"Tom");       System.out.println(name.get(p)); } 以上就是java反射调用指定属性

    45920

    REDHAWK——波形

    组装控制器是波形中指定为委托波形级别 start()、stop()、configure() 和 query() 调用组件实例。在复杂波形中,组装控制器可以用来协调组件生命周期。...以下步骤解释了如何设置组装控制器并描述波形。 在波形概览标签页上,控制器下拉菜单中确保选择了 SigGen_1。 在描述字段中,输入波形描述。...图表标签页,可以指示波形外部端口,并且可以将组装控制器角色指派给一个组件。 ①、在波形中编辑组件属性 图表标签页,可以设置组件属性。...当这些属性被设置时,它们变成特定于波形,并被写入描述此波形 *.sad.xml 文件中。 以下步骤解释了如何在波形中编辑组件属性。 在波形图表标签页,选择组件。...有关设备需求集更多信息,请参考将组件绑定到可执行设备相关内容。 以下步骤解释如何编辑设备需求集。 在波形图表标签页上,选择组件。 在属性视图中,确认需求标签页已被选中。

    13310

    Go语言如何利用反射机制 动态调用结构体中方法和属性

    相信做个PHP同学,在很多时候都使用过如下方式去调用一个类中方法,或者某个属性。...都会把不同平台实现方式封装成一个扩展,然后在调用时通过一个工厂类去处理调用具体扩展,只要保证每一个扩展中返回参数格式一致就可以了。...在Go语言中,要实现这样操作,可以采用这样思路,但是在调用地方就不能这么写。因为Go语言属于编译型语言,发现找不到对应方法,就会编译不通过。...package mainimport ("fmt""reflect")// 使用interface限定参数类型,动态调用struct中方法、方法type A1 interface {Show1(name...struct中方法reflect.ValueOf(a).MethodByName(menthod).Call(inputs)// 动态调用struct中属性fmt.Println("所有属性值",

    19320

    Spring MVC 学习总结(四)——视图与综合示例

    这个标签典型用法是一次声明多个标签实例,所有的标签都有相同path属性,但是他们value属性不同。...在生成HTML代码中,被选中选项和表单支持对象相应属性值保持一致。这个标签也支持嵌套option和options标签。...运行结果: 1.8、option标签 这个标签生成HTML option标签,可以用于生成select表单元素中单项,没有path属性,有label与value属性。...HTML option标签,可以用它生成select标签标签,在控制器中新增两个action,代码如下: //options @RequestMapping("/action61")...这两个标签生成HTML代码是相同,但是第一个option标签允许你在JSP中明确声明这个标签值只供显示使用,并不绑定到表单支持对象属性上。

    1.7K10

    4、Angular JS 学习笔记 – 创建自定义指令

    下面的代码也匹配ngModel: 标准化 Angular标准化一个元素标签属性名称去确定一个元素匹配哪个指令...标准化过程如下: 元素或者属性去除x-和data-前缀 转换带有分隔符 :, -,或 _ 名称为驼峰格式: 举例来说,下面的方式是相同都匹配ngBind指令。...Angular将调用templateUrl函数基于两个参数,一个是指令是在哪个元素上被调用,和一个attr属性关联相关元素。...什么时候我应该使用属性而不是元素? 当你在模板中创建一个控制器组件时候,你应该使用元素。通常情况是当你创建一个特定领域语言给你模板。...通常隔离作用域通过表达式获取父级数据,它可以通过一个本地变量name和value组成map放到表达式包装函数。

    4.8K20

    零到部署:用 Vue 和 Express 实现迷你全栈电商应用(三)

    data 中,定义了 _id 和 value 值,然后我们通过在 模板中使用 v-bind 语法动态option 标签 id 和 value 属性赋值,最后结果看起来是这样...: 当然,当需要绑定属性多了,每次都写 v-bind 显得相当繁琐,所以 Vue 为我们提供了 v-bind 简洁语法 :,即我们之前绑定语法...,每次 manufacturers 中取一个元素,并赋值给 manufacturer ,然后我们就可以在 option 标签中使用 manufacturer 和我们定义 model 进行比较。..._id 为 1,它和 manufacturers 数组第一项元素 _id 一致,所以我们返回两个 option 标签,第一个 selected 属性为 true,第二个为 false。...接着我们对 manufacturers 进行循环遍历,构造多个 option 标签选项,然后使用了属性绑定语法简洁写法绑定了 option value 和 selected 属性,value 属性赋值为

    1.3K10

    零到部署:用 Vue 和 Express 实现迷你全栈电商应用(三)

    data 中,定义了 _id 和 value 值,然后我们通过在 模板中使用 v-bind 语法动态option 标签 id 和 value 属性赋值,最后结果看起来是这样...: 当然,当需要绑定属性多了,每次都写 v-bind 显得相当繁琐,所以 Vue 为我们提供了 v-bind 简洁语法 :,即我们之前绑定语法...,每次 manufacturers 中取一个元素,并赋值给 manufacturer ,然后我们就可以在 option 标签中使用 manufacturer 和我们定义 model 进行比较。..._id 为 1,它和 manufacturers 数组第一项元素 _id 一致,所以我们返回两个 option 标签,第一个 selected 属性为 true,第二个为 false。...接着我们对 manufacturers 进行循环遍历,构造多个 option 标签选项,然后使用了属性绑定语法简洁写法绑定了 option value 和 selected 属性,value 属性赋值为

    1.3K50

    PHP 学习笔记之一:thinkPHPvolist标签

    Volist标签主要用于在模板中循环输出数据集或者多维数组。 属性name : 必须,输出数据模板变量,后台提供变量。 id : 必须,是循环变量,可以随便定义,但是不能跟name相同。...这样就循环输出username offset : 可选,模板变量第几个开始循环。...vo" empty="暂时没有数据" > {$vo.name} 拓展一下: 2.1版开始允许在模板中直接使用函数设定数据集,而不需要在控制器中给模板变量赋值传入数据集变量...{$vo.goods_name} 在下拉列表里面,根据后台提供数据,动态添加option选项。...在里面,用php代码,实现select动态显示option值,而在php代码块中,使用volist变量,则要使用$vo[‘goods_name’]

    2.1K90

    前端MVC学习总结(二)——AngularJS验证、过滤器、指令

    一、验证 angularJS中提供了许多验证指令,可以轻松实现验证,只需要在表单元素上添加相应ng属性,常见的如下所示: <input Type="text" ng-model="" [name=...这是angular支持基于“视图-模型-控制器”设计模式原则主要方面。 Angular中MVC组件有: 模型 — 模型是一个域属性集合;域被附加到DOM上,通过绑定来存取域属性。...视图 — 模板(进行数据绑定HTML)会被呈现到视图中。 控制器 — ngController指令声明一个控制器类;该类包含了业务逻辑,在应用后台使用函数和值来操控域中属性。...这是通过调用$sce.getTrustedResourceUrl 实现。为了其它域名和协议载入模板,你可以采用 白名单化 或 包裹化 任一手段来作为可信任值。...因为使用了replace属性,所以div标签被替换了,另外restrict指定为AE则标签可以作为元素与属性使用。

    15.4K60

    Java学习笔记-全栈-web开发-24-Vue

    改变也会同步视图更新相关依赖, 双向绑定就是vm起了作用 Vue与后端模板引擎区别就在于: 后端模板引擎后端控制器Model中获取数据,然后通过形如th:text="${}"指令将数据渲染到...,v-if会将渲染页面的标签直接进行删除/添加操作,而v-show是更改标签display属性。...父组件向子组件传递属性 vue实例是一个父组件,先看vue实例中数据如何传递给vue实例中私有组件(即子组件)。...") } } } } }) 关键步骤: 子组件被调用地方加上ref属性(即自定义标签名处,而不是声明子组件...template上) 父组件中通过$refs找到该refdom元素,然后调用子组件方法 7.7 注意点 组件只有一个属性值,但是属性值中可以写任意html代码,而且,必须只能有一个根节点(最外层必须要有一个标签包裹着

    1.2K20

    .NET 云原生架构师训练营(模块二 基础巩固 MVC终结点)--学习笔记

    view=aspnetcore-5.0 什么是模型绑定 控制器和 Razor 页面处理来自 HTTP 请求数据。例如,路由数据可以提供一个记录键,而发布表单域可以为模型属性提供一个值。...Razor在方法参数和公共属性中向控制器和页面提供数据。 将字符串数据转换为 .NET 类型。 更新复杂类型属性。 来源有哪些 [FromQuery] -查询字符串获取值。...] string termId) { return Ok(new {id, name, termId}); } 已发布表单字段中获取值 [HttpPost] [Route("option/...Ok(new {name, id}); } 请求正文中获取值 [HttpPost] [Route("option/body")] public IActionResult CreateOption(...[StringLength]:验证字符串属性值是否不超过指定长度限制。 [Url]:验证属性是否具有 URL 格式。 [Remote]:通过在服务器上调用操作方法来验证客户端上输入。

    2.5K10

    .NET 云原生架构师训练营(模块二 基础巩固 MVC终结点)--学习笔记

    view=aspnetcore-5.0 什么是模型绑定 控制器和 Razor 页面处理来自 HTTP 请求数据。 例如,路由数据可以提供一个记录键,而发布表单域可以为模型属性提供一个值。...Razor在方法参数和公共属性中向控制器和页面提供数据。 将字符串数据转换为 .NET 类型。 更新复杂类型属性。 来源有哪些 [FromQuery] -查询字符串获取值。...] string termId) { return Ok(new {id, name, termId}); } 已发布表单字段中获取值 [HttpPost] [Route("option/from...{name, id}); } 请求正文中获取值 [HttpPost] [Route("option/body")] public IActionResult CreateOption([FromBody...[StringLength]:验证字符串属性值是否不超过指定长度限制。 [Url]:验证属性是否具有 URL 格式。 [Remote]:通过在服务器上调用操作方法来验证客户端上输入。

    2.6K11
    领券